David Zeuthen authored
The update_engine daemon from Brillo is expected to be used also in Android so move its selinux policy to AOSP. Put update_engine in the whitelist (currently only has the recovery there) allowing it to bypass the notallow for writing to partititions labeled as system_block_device. Also introduce the misc_block_device dev_type as update_engine in some configurations may need to read/write the misc partition. Jeff Sharkey authored
We have a bunch of magic that mounts the correct view of storage access based on the runtime permissions of an app, but we forgot to protect the real underlying data sources; oops. This series of changes just bumps the directory heirarchy one level to give us /mnt/runtime which we can mask off as 0700 to prevent people from jumping to the exposed internals. Jeff Sharkey authored
Now that we're treating storage as a runtime permission, we need to grant read/write access without killing the app. This is really tricky, since we had been using GIDs for access control, and they're set in stone once Zygote drops privileges. The only thing left that can change dynamically is the filesystem itself, so let's do that. This means changing the FUSE daemon to present itself as three different views: /mnt/runtime_default/foo - view for apps with no access /mnt/runtime_read/foo - view for apps with read access /mnt/runtime_write/foo - view for apps with write access There is still a single location for all the backing files, and filesystem permissions are derived the same way for each view, but the file modes are masked off differently for each mountpoint. During Zygote fork, it wires up the appropriate storage access into an isolated mount namespace based on the current app permissions. Stephen Smalley authored
Run idmap in its own domain rather than leaving it in installd's domain. This prevents misuse of installd's permissions by idmap. zygote also needs to run idmap. For now, just run it in zygote's domain as it was previously since that is what is done for dex2oat invocation by zygote. zygote appears to run idmap with system uid while installd runs it with app UIDs, so using different domains seems appropriate. Remove system_file execute_no_trans from both installd and zygote; this should no longer be needed with explicit labels for dex2oat and idmap. Nick Kralevich authored
Files on the /oem partition are weird. The /oem partition is an ext4 partition, built in the Android tree using the "oem_image" build target added in build/ commit b8888432f0bc0706d5e00e971dde3ac2e986f2af. Since it's an ext4 image, it requires SELinux labels to be defined at build time. However, the partition is mounted using context=u:object_r:oemfs:s0, which ignores the labels on the filesystem. Assign all the files on the /oem image to be oemfs, which is consistent with how they'll be mounted when /oem is mounted. Other options would be to use an "unlabeled" label, or try to fix the build system to not require SELinux labels for /oem images. Jeff Sharkey authored
An upcoming platform release is redesigning how external storage works. At a high level, vold is taking on a more active role in managing devices that dynamically appear. This change also creates further restricted domains for tools doing low-level access of external storage devices, including sgdisk and blkid. It also extends sdcardd to be launchable by vold, since launching by init will eventually go away. For compatibility, rules required to keep AOSP builds working are marked with "TODO" to eventually remove. Slightly relax system_server external storage rules to allow calls like statfs(). Still neverallow open file descriptors, since they can cause kernel to kill us.
